MySQL求交集:精准结果获取(mysql求交集)

MySQL求交集是一个常用的操作,对于实现数据库查询、信息整理和报表,大家都常用SQL查询来实现,这是一个简单的任务,但也非常有用的功能,本文介绍了MySQL求交集的具体方法,帮助大家实现数据库查询功能。

在求交集时,MySQL提供了多种求交集的途径,其中最常用的有:INNER JOIN、UNION、INTERSECT、EXCEPT等操作,每种方法都有它自己的特点和功能,我们可以根据实际需要来选择适合的方式,以达到合理有效利用MySQL查询精准结果。

MySQL用于求交集的表达式有INNER JOIN和UNION,这两个求交集的方法都可以从两个表或多个表中查找匹配的记录,返回符合搜索条件的记录,从而实现精准的求交集运算。

下面,我来以实例说明如何使用MySQL INNNER JOIN和UNION实现查找表中正确的结果。

1、使用INNER JOIN

INNER JOIN的SQL语句示例如下:

“`mysql

SELECT t1.name,t2.sex

FROM table1 t1

INNER JOIN table2 t2

ON t1.id = t2.id

其中,table1和table2都有相同的字段id,上面的这句SQL语句是根据id来查询table1和table2中两个表中都有相同的内容,从而实现求交集操作。
2、使用UNION

UNION的SQL语句示例如下:
```mysql
SELECT t1.name
FROM table1 t1
UNION
SELECT t2.sex
FROM table2 t2

上面的这句SQL语句是查询table1和table2中两个表中都有的name和sex字段,从而实现求交集操作,查询返回的结果即为交集,大大提高了查询效率和精准结果获取。

上面所介绍的就是MySQL求交集的具体方法,本文介绍了使用INNER JOIN和UNION等SQL操作实现精准结果获取的方法。以上就是MySQL求交集的具体实例,希望文章中所介绍的MySQL求交集的实现方法能够帮助你实现数据库查询功能,精准结果获取。


数据运维技术 » MySQL求交集:精准结果获取(mysql求交集)